Lemonis recently assumed the CEO role at Bed Bath & Beyond alongside his Executive Chairman duties, unveiling ambitious plans for 300-store relaunches nationwide—skipping California due to regulatory hurdles—and pursuing acquisitions to hit $1.5 billion in revenue from brands like Overstock and buybuy BABY. He grew Camping World from startup to America's dominant RV dealer over 25 years before shifting to Special Advisor, with CEO retirement set for early 2026. Beyond retail, Lemonis showcases his turnaround expertise on FOX's The Fixer, evaluating and rescuing faltering companies, following his CNBC stint on The Profit. From his South Florida base, he invests in local startups and delivers keynotes like the January 2026 Power Forward Series in Tallahassee, preaching his 3 P's framework: People, Process, Product.
